IMPORTANT: Before each use, visually check the meter to ensure it is
securely connected to other system components and there is no leakage.
Promptly wipe spilled fuel from the meter's exterior and other system
components.
NOTE: The large meter display represents the Batch Total for each fuel
delivery. Before dispensing, reset the Batch Total to zero by turning the
knob (see Figure 5)
NOTE: The small display represents the Cumulative Total of all fuel
deliveries and cannot be reset.
Calibration
The Calibration Screw is located on the side of the meter (see Figure 6) and
can be adjusted with a 3mm hex wrench. The meter is accurately calibrated
at the factory for use with diesel fuel. In the event the screw is accidentally
moved, the meter will need to be recalibrated. To recalibrate the meter for
diesel fuel, turn the screw completely in (clockwise) then back out (counter-
clockwise) 3 turns.
To recalibrate the meter for gasoline, turn the screw completely in
(clockwise). The Cal-screw does not need to be turned back out for
gasoline.
Due to differences in viscosity and flow rates, the meter may require
recalibration to measure other fluids or to adjust for inaccuracies.
In general, if the register indicates less than what is dispensed, the
Cal-Screw needs turned in; if the register indicates more than what was
dispensed, the Cal-Screw needs turned out.
NOTE: Never back the Cal-Screw out more than 12 turns from completely
closed. Doing so could inhibit the seal resulting in leaking.
